Every release of the SproutCycle plant-watering scheduler must carry verifiable provenance. The build farm at Fennwick Labs signs each artifact after compilation, and the attestation records the source revision, builder identity, and dependency lockfile digest. Before promoting a candidate, confirm the attestation chain is unbroken and that the signing key matches the current quarter's rotation. Do not promote builds lacking a complete chain. The verified token for this release is recorded directly below.

pipeline stamp: htk3_cc5

QUARTERLY PLANNING NOTE — FY Headcount

Department heads: submit revised headcount asks by end of month. Baseline is flat. Exceptions limited to the Oriole platform team and field service in the Calverton region. Backfills require VP sign-off; contractor conversions count against quota. No new management layers. Lenka will circulate the template this week. Context for why we are holding flat, which must not leave this group, follows below.

board note of kageg-bahof: The renewal with Holwynax Holdings closes at $2 million a year, 5 percent below the last contract. Project Ulaath slips by two quarters because of the supplier delay.

Subject: Marketing budget — heads up

Hi all,

Quick note before the branch calls tomorrow: we're trimming the marketing budget by roughly 15% for the rest of the year. The Larkspur campaign stays, but regional print and the Tollbridge sponsorship are paused. I know this stings, especially for the coastal branches that were mid-launch. Please keep messaging consistent — this is a reallocation, not a retreat. There's context behind the move that the exec team should see, so I'm including it confidentially below.

internal memo for kahop-yajof: The steering committee signed off on a budget of $12.6 million for Project Jorwyn. The renewal with Quenoxox Logistics closes at $16.8 million a year, 48 percent above the last contract.

Document Transport — Print Shop Master Copies

Quick guide for moving master copies to Bramblehurst Print Co. These are the only originals, so treat the run like a valuables transfer, not a regular parcel drop. Use the red tamper-evident envelopes from the supply shelf, log the seal number in the transport book, and never combine the run with general mail. The masters go directly to the press supervisor, nobody else. On arrival, the courier must follow the hand-over instruction stated below.

drop instructions, kajep-tageg: the kasvan casdor courier leaves the quenvan quenox druox ledger at gate 4316 under passcode 799004